Fusion research is reaching a pivotal phase, with major facilities striving to attain the critical breakthrough of net energy production.

Achieving sustained fusion requires heating fuel to extreme temperatures of 100 million degrees. This transforms the fuel into plasma, presenting significant confinement and control difficulties. Advanced international projects employing high-power lasers and superconducting magnet technology represent vital progress toward viable fusion power, though numerous obstacles remain.

This MSc program equips you to tackle these issues. You'll develop expertise in computational and experimental plasma physics while performing innovative research alongside leading physicists at the York Plasma Institute.

The program offers exceptional access to globally renowned fusion experts, making the MSc in Fusion Energy an ideal pathway to pursue your fusion interests and launch a career in this transformative field.
